Output fe81ded575cbb141973c3a62ae298d34f16002e97ed55ab4eaafb3c6bfa4913f:2

value
306684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2069257c9e31c88772276d839bd60005491c59f OP_EQUAL
address
3GTjGE6msrEPxBBhYJT5h1GR2SP4GXDZzU
transaction
fe81ded575cbb141973c3a62ae298d34f16002e97ed55ab4eaafb3c6bfa4913f
spent
true